Disqualifiers for Employment:
NOTE THIS LIST OF DISQUALIFIERS ARE NOT INCLUSIVE
Applicant’s Driving Record:
Candidates will not be considered who have violations exceeding those as defined below:
· More than three (3) vehicle accidents on the applicant’s Department of Public Safety driving record during the preceding thirty-six (36) months.
· More than three (3) traffic Convictions resulting from separate incidents on the applicant’s Department of Public Safety driving record during the preceding thirty-six (36) months. Parking, registration, and equipment convictions are excluded.
Applicant’s Criminal History:
· Candidates will not be considered who have a criminal record in Texas or any other state or Territory of the United States of America as delineated below:
· Have been on court-ordered community supervision or probation for any criminal offense that is a Class B MISDEMEANOR or above within the last ten (10) years from the date of the court order.
· Have been convicted of an offense a Class B MISDEMEANOR within the last ten (10) years
· Have been on court-ordered community service or probation for any criminal offense above the grade of a Class B MISDEMEANOR.
· Have been convicted of a criminal offense above the grade of a Class B MISDEMEANOR.
· Is currently under indictment for any offense.
· Is currently charged with any criminal offense for which conviction would prevent the ability to be licensed or be currently under a Protective Order.
· Expungements. Under Texas law expungements are not accepted on convictions, even if the sentence was probation. Expungements from another state must meet the same standards as Texas law.
Texas Commission on Law Enforcement License Status:
· Candidates will not be considered who have had a Texas Commission on Law Enforcement Officer Standards and Education License denied by final order or revoked, currently on suspension, or have a voluntary surrender of license currently in effect.
· Candidates must not have been dismissed or resigned in lieu of dismissal from employment for inefficiency or misconduct.
· Candidates must not have a Designation of Separation from another law enforcement agency that is below an Honorable Discharge.
Illegal Drug and Excessive Alcohol Usage:
Candidates will not be considered who have violations exceeding those as defined below:
· Have illegally used marijuana within the last two years preceding the date of appointment.
· Have used a drug listed in a Penalty Group as defined in Section 481 of the Texas Health and Safety Code without a prescription, or that was prescribed to another as an adult (18 and older).
· Have used a drug (including illegal use of prescription drugs and anabolic steroids) as an adult (18 and older) that tends to establish a pattern.
· Have sold, manufactured, distributed, or cultivated illegal drugs, including marihuana as an adult (18 and older).
· Have be shown by a physician to be drug dependent or a user of illegal drugs.
Fitness Requirements for CBC Police Officers:
· Applicant is physically and mentally able to perform the essential functions of the position, as measured by the following:
· Physical Ability Assessment
· All applicants must pass a work-related physical readiness assessment on the CBC 1.5-mile walking track located on the Beeville Campus at a time below 25 minutes; complete 10 pushups and 10 sit-ups within 5 minutes after completion of the 1.5-mile walk/run. The physical readiness assessment is pass/ fail.· Psychological Examination if separation from another law enforcement agency has been more than 180 days from the date of hire.· Drug Testing if separation from another law enforcement agency had been more than 180 days from the date of hire.
